Today, on The Climate Daily, the U.S government pays the state of Virginia $64 million dollars to clean up the Elizabeth River. Britain pledges to protect 265,000 square miles of ocean. Virginia governor Ralph Northam pledges $10 million in capital funds to restore oyster beds in the Chesapeake Bay. And 14 nations pledge to stop overfishing.
